- The Resort -


The Elua Village consists of only 153 condos spread across a 23-acre site, so there are beautiful open spaces and views everywhere. Palm trees, tropical flowers, and orchids abound. There are two pool areas, both recently remodeled. The upper pool area has a jacuzzi spa. The lower pool and pavilion area is absolutely stunning and located right next to the beach. The pavilion has a full kitchen, shared BBQs, both covered and uncovered areas for dining and relaxing, a lending library, and gym/workout room with a view of the ocean!




Elua 1804 is situated in the right side of the Wailea Elua Village property. We are only 75 yards from Ulua beach -- just a 30 second walk to the sand and the world famous 2-mile Wailea Beach Walk that connects all the beachfront resorts along the stunning South Maui shoreline.

Take a trip that gives back


The Hawaiian Islands itinerary that can change your life isn’t found in any guidebooks. Because what makes the Hawaiian Islands truly special is not only our stunning natural beauty or our vibrant culture - it’s the deeply rooted relationship that connects them.

That relationship between people and place grows stronger every time you malama (give back). When you give back - to the land, the ocean, the wildlife, the forest, the fishpond, the community - you’re part of a virtuous circle that enriches everything and everyone. Including your experience as a visitor.

Several organizations offer opportunities for visitors to pay it forward, like beach clean-ups, native tree planting, and more. Giving Thanks & Sharing Aloha


The practice of reciprocation is deeply ingrained in our island communities because we rely so heavily on one another in modern times, and historically, too. It’s one of the most cherished parts of life in Hawaii. Sharing aloha is a time-honored way of giving thanks and showing gratitude.
